>First of all the autor of that webpage suggests to perform following steps:
>
>"2.Click Edit, click New, and then click String Record.
> 3.Verify that the entry in the ID box is Other, and then type 41661
>(decimal) on the right side of the ID box."
>
>You can choose 'Other' when creating new String Record only with MetaEdit
>tool, not with Metabase Explorer. Current version of MetaEdit is 2.2 (latest
>version that I've found on micorosoft.com) and it only supports IIS up to 5.0
>(my server uses IIS 6.0 and Exchange 2003). Knowing that, I've decided to
>switch to Metabase Explorer, but unfortunately, when creating new String
>Record it doesn't allow you to choose 'Other' !That 'New Record' box in field
>'Record Name or Identifier' will only allow to choose between predefined
>values, preventing from choosing 'Other' and typing value 41661 as
>http://www.petri.co.il/change_the_pop3_banner.htm tells.
>
>Any suggestions how to work arround this problem? Is there a MetaEdit
>version that supports IIS 6.0?..... or am I missing something?
>Please respond 'cause that problem haunts me....

The IIS6 metabase is an xml file. You can use notepad (or anything
that will save the file in the format it's read in) to make any
changes you like to the file. :)

Put this into the '<IIsPop3Server Location="/LM/POP3SVC/1" . . . '
section of the file. Save the file[1]. There's no need to restart any
services.


<Custom
Name="POP3Banner"
ID="41661"
Value="Hi there, this is a POP3 server!"
Type="STRING"
UserType="IIS_MD_UT_SERVER"
Attributes="NO_ATTRIBUTES"
/>

[1] Check the "Enable Direct Metabase Edit" checkbox on the IIS root
before you begin.
